5-Amino-1-methylquinolinium iodide
A small-molecule selective inhibitor of nicotinamide N-methyltransferase (NNMT) characterised in metabolic and adipose-research literature. Not a peptide chemically (it is a methylquinolinium derivative) but commonly co-studied with peptide GLP-1 agonists in metabolic models.
ActRIIB-Fc; soluble activin receptor type IIB
A recombinant fusion protein consisting of the extracellular domain of ActRIIB linked to a human IgG Fc region. Studied in published literature as a myostatin / activin pathway antagonist with reported effects on skeletal muscle mass in preclinical models.
Adrenocorticotropic hormone; corticotropin
A 39-residue peptide hormone derived from the proopiomelanocortin (POMC) precursor. The canonical reference standard for melanocortin receptor (MC2R) and HPA-axis research, well-characterised across decades of endocrinology literature.
Combination GHRH / GHS research blend
A research-use blend formulation that pairs a GHRH analogue with a ghrelin-mimetic GH secretagogue. Studied in the GH-axis literature for the synergy between the two pathways converging on pituitary somatotrophs.
FTPP; CKGGRAKDC-GG-D(KLAKLAK)2
A peptidomimetic chimera that targets prohibitin on the surface of white adipose vasculature, characterised in published preclinical literature for adipose-specific apoptotic research models. Distinctive for its tissue-targeting domain rather than a receptor-agonist mechanism.
5-Aminoimidazole-4-carboxamide ribonucleotide; Acadesine
A nucleoside analogue and AMPK activator widely characterised in metabolic-research literature. Not a peptide chemically (it is an adenosine analogue) but commonly studied alongside peptide metabolic compounds because of its distinct AMPK-mediated mechanism.
Anti-obesity drug 9604; hGH 177-191 fragment analogue
A 16-amino-acid synthetic fragment analogue of the C-terminus of human growth hormone (residues 177-191), with a tyrosine added at the N-terminus. Studied in published metabolic literature for lipolytic activity decoupled from the somatogenic effects of full-length GH.
Cibinetide; ARA-290; Helix B Surface Peptide
An 11-amino-acid synthetic peptide derived from the helix B surface of erythropoietin (EPO) and engineered to bind the heteromeric tissue-protective receptor (EPOR/CD131) without the haematopoietic activity of EPO itself. Characterised in inflammation and tissue-repair literature.
AT-II
An octapeptide hormone of the renin-angiotensin system (RAS), one of the most extensively cited reference peptides in cardiovascular and renal pharmacology. Listed here as a reference; stocked separately as a research-grade reference standard from specialist suppliers.

Body Protection Compound-157; Pentadecapeptide BPC-157
A 15-amino-acid synthetic peptide derived from a partial sequence of human gastric juice protein. One of the most widely cited regenerative-research peptides, characterised in extensive preclinical literature for tendon, gut-mucosal and connective-tissue repair models.
Vitamin B12; Mecobalamin
The methylated, biologically active form of vitamin B12 used as a research reference standard in metabolic, neurological and haematology pharmacology. Not a peptide chemically (it is a corrin-cobalt complex) but supplied as a research-grade reagent alongside the peptide catalogue.

AM833
A long-acting amylin analogue characterised in published metabolic-research literature, frequently studied in combination with semaglutide as a dual-mechanism research compound. Acts at amylin and calcitonin receptor family targets.
Drug Affinity Complex GHRH analogue
A modified 30-amino-acid GHRH analogue carrying a maleimidopropionic acid (DAC) moiety that covalently binds serum albumin, dramatically extending the half-life relative to native GHRH or unmodified analogues. Widely cited in long-acting GH-axis research.
Modified GRF 1-29; ModGRF
The same modified GHRH backbone as CJC-1295 (DAC) but lacking the albumin-binding maleimide. Half-life is approximately 30 minutes, longer than native GHRH(1-29) but much shorter than the DAC-modified version. Widely cited in pulsatile GH-research.

Delta Sleep-Inducing Peptide
A 9-amino-acid neuropeptide originally isolated from rabbit cerebral venous blood and characterised in CNS / sleep-architecture research literature. The mechanism in published research is not fully resolved; multiple receptor-system interactions are reported.
LY2189265
A long-acting GLP-1 receptor agonist consisting of two GLP-1(7-37) analogue molecules covalently linked to a modified human IgG4 Fc fragment. Characterised across published incretin pharmacology literature.

Epitalon; AEDG tetrapeptide
A short 4-amino-acid synthetic peptide originating from research at the St Petersburg Institute of Bioregulation and Gerontology. Characterised in published Russian literature for telomerase / pineal-gland research models.
Exendin-4
A 39-amino-acid peptide originally isolated from the salivary secretions of the Gila monster (Heloderma suspectum) and acting as a GLP-1 receptor agonist with greater enzymatic stability than native GLP-1. One of the most extensively cited GLP-1 reference compounds in incretin literature.

FOXO4 D-Retro-Inverso peptide
A D-amino-acid retro-inverso peptide engineered to disrupt the FOXO4-p53 interaction, characterised in published senescence-research literature for selective senolytic activity in preclinical models.
FST-315; FST-344
An autocrine glycoprotein characterised in published myostatin / activin signalling literature as an antagonist of activin and myostatin via direct binding. Both 315-residue and 344-residue isoforms are studied.

Copper Tripeptide-1; Glycyl-L-histidyl-L-lysine:copper
A tripeptide-copper complex consisting of glycyl-L-histidyl-L-lysine bound to a Cu²⁺ ion. One of the most extensively cited regenerative-research peptides, with hundreds of publications spanning copper biochemistry, collagen synthesis, and dermal-research models.
Growth Hormone Releasing Peptide-2; Pralmorelin
A 6-amino-acid synthetic ghrelin-mimetic GH secretagogue acting on the growth-hormone secretagogue receptor (GHS-R). One of the canonical reference compounds in GHS-R research alongside GHRP-6 and Hexarelin.
Growth Hormone Releasing Peptide-6
A 6-amino-acid synthetic GH secretagogue and the original ghrelin-mimetic discovered before the endogenous ligand ghrelin was identified. Acts on GHS-R1a; characterised across decades of GH-axis literature.
GSH; reduced glutathione; gamma-Glu-Cys-Gly
A 3-amino-acid intracellular tripeptide (gamma-Glu-Cys-Gly) and the principal endogenous low-molecular-weight thiol antioxidant in mammalian cells. Widely used as a reference standard in redox-biology research.
GnRH; LHRH; Gonadotropin-Releasing Hormone
A 10-amino-acid hypothalamic decapeptide and the natural ligand for the GnRH receptor on pituitary gonadotrophs. The canonical reference standard for HPG-axis pharmacology research.

Human Chorionic Gonadotropin
A heterodimeric glycoprotein hormone with an alpha subunit shared with LH/FSH/TSH and a beta subunit specific to HCG. The canonical reference standard for LH receptor pharmacology research.
Human Growth Hormone; Somatotropin; Recombinant hGH 1-191
A 191-amino-acid recombinant human growth hormone identical in sequence to the endogenous pituitary peptide. The canonical reference standard for GH receptor / JAK2-STAT5 signalling research.
Examorelin
A 6-amino-acid synthetic GH secretagogue closely related to GHRP-6, characterised in published GH-axis literature. Reported in research as having additional CD36-mediated cardiovascular activity beyond GHS-R1a binding.

Long R3 IGF-1; Long Arg3 Insulin-like Growth Factor-1
A 83-amino-acid analogue of IGF-1 with an additional 13-residue N-terminal extension and an arginine substitution at position 3. Reduced binding to IGF binding proteins gives an extended half-life relative to native IGF-1.
NNC 26-0161
A 5-amino-acid selective ghrelin-mimetic GH secretagogue. Distinct from GHRP-2 and GHRP-6 in that the published profile reports minimal cortisol or prolactin release, making it the most selective GHS-R1a compound for research purposes.

Metastin 45-54; Kp-10
The C-terminal 10-amino-acid fragment of the 54-residue Kisspeptin-54 / Metastin precursor and a high-affinity ligand at the GPR54 (KISS1R) receptor. The canonical reference compound for hypothalamic-pituitary-gonadal (HPG) axis research.

NN2211
A long-acting GLP-1 receptor agonist consisting of a GLP-1(7-37) analogue with a fatty acid (palmitic acid) attached via a glutamic acid spacer at Lys26. The fatty-acid acylation enables albumin binding and extends the half-life relative to native GLP-1.
Cathelicidin antimicrobial peptide; CAMP
A 37-amino-acid host-defence peptide processed from the human cathelicidin precursor hCAP-18. Characterised across innate-immunity literature for broad antimicrobial and immunomodulatory activity.

IBI362; LY3305677
A GLP-1 / glucagon dual receptor agonist characterised in published Phase 2 metabolic-research literature. Distinct from triple agonists (e.g., Retatrutide) by lacking GIP activity.
N-acetyl-5-methoxytryptamine
An endogenous indoleamine derived from serotonin via N-acetylation and O-methylation, secreted by the pineal gland. Not a peptide chemically but supplied as a research reference standard for circadian and antioxidant research alongside the peptide catalogue.
Mitochondrial-derived peptide
A 16-amino-acid mitochondrial-derived peptide encoded within the 12S rRNA region of mitochondrial DNA. Characterised in metabolic-research literature for AMPK-mediated effects in skeletal muscle and adipose models.
Melanotan-1; NDP-MSH; [Nle&sup4;, D-Phe⁷]-α-MSH
A 13-amino-acid synthetic analogue of alpha-melanocyte-stimulating hormone with a norleucine-4 and D-phenylalanine-7 substitution that increases potency and metabolic stability at melanocortin receptors.
Melanotan-II; Ac-Nle-cyclo[Asp-His-D-Phe-Arg-Trp-Lys]-NH₂
A 7-amino-acid cyclic synthetic analogue of alpha-MSH with a lactam bridge between Asp² and Lys⁷. The cyclic structure provides metabolic stability and broad melanocortin receptor agonism.
Mechano Growth Factor; IGF-1Ec splice variant
A splice variant of the IGF-1 gene producing a 24-amino-acid C-terminal peptide called MGF, characterised in published muscle-research literature for its role in mechanical-load-induced satellite cell activation. PEG-MGF refers to the polyethylene-glycolated stabilised form.

Nicotinamide adenine dinucleotide
A pyridine dinucleotide cofactor essential to redox metabolism, energy production and sirtuin / PARP signalling. Not a peptide chemically (it is a dinucleotide) but supplied as a research-grade reference standard alongside the peptide catalogue. Widely cited in mitochondrial and ageing-research literature.

OXT
A 9-amino-acid cyclic neuropeptide hormone with a disulfide bridge between Cys1 and Cys6. Synthesised in the hypothalamus and released from the posterior pituitary; the canonical reference peptide for social-bonding, reproductive and CNS research.

Bremelanotide; PT141
A cyclic 7-amino-acid heptapeptide melanocortin agonist derived from MT-2 by replacing the C-terminal amide with a free carboxylic acid. Characterised in published literature for selectivity towards MC4R / MC3R relative to MC1R.

LY3437943
A 39-amino-acid synthetic peptide and triple agonist at the GLP-1, GIP and glucagon receptors. Characterised in published Phase 2 metabolic-research literature with the largest reported weight-related outcomes of any single-compound incretin programme to date.

TP-7-tuftsin analogue
A 7-amino-acid synthetic peptide originating from research at the V.V. Zakusov Research Institute of Pharmacology. A heptapeptide analogue of the immunomodulatory tetrapeptide tuftsin, characterised in published literature for anxiolytic and GABAergic research.
NN9535
A 31-amino-acid GLP-1 receptor agonist with two amino acid substitutions and a fatty-diacid acylation that enables strong albumin binding. The most extensively cited single-target GLP-1 agonist in current metabolic-research literature.
Met-Glu-His-Phe-Pro-Gly-Pro; Russian nootropic peptide
A 7-amino-acid synthetic peptide derived from the ACTH(4-10) fragment with a C-terminal Pro-Gly-Pro tripeptide added for enzymatic stability. Characterised in published Russian neuroscience literature for BDNF / NGF modulation in CNS-research models.
GHRH(1-29); GRF(1-29)
A 29-amino-acid synthetic peptide corresponding to the first 29 residues of native human growth-hormone-releasing hormone. The canonical reference standard for GHRH receptor pharmacology research.

Thymosin Beta-4 fragment; LKKTETQ-related
A synthetic fragment representing the active region of full-length Thymosin Beta-4 (the actin-binding 17-LKKTETQ-23 motif and surrounding residues). Characterised in published literature for actin sequestration and angiogenesis-related tissue-repair models.
TH9507; trans-3-hexenoyl-GHRH(1-44)NH₂
A 44-amino-acid GHRH analogue corresponding to native human GHRH(1-44) with a trans-3-hexenoyl moiety attached to the N-terminus to enhance enzymatic stability. Characterised in published literature for adipose-distribution research models.
Tα1; Thymalfasin
A 28-amino-acid acetylated peptide derived from the prothymosin alpha precursor, originally isolated from bovine thymic extracts. Widely cited in immunomodulatory research as a TLR-9 / TLR-2 modulator.
LY3298176
A 39-amino-acid synthetic peptide and dual agonist at the GIP and GLP-1 receptors with a C20 fatty-diacid moiety enabling albumin binding. The most cited dual incretin reference compound in current metabolic-research literature.

Vasoactive Intestinal Polypeptide
A 28-amino-acid peptide hormone of the secretin / glucagon superfamily, released from neurons throughout the central and peripheral nervous system. The reference standard for VPAC1 / VPAC2 receptor research.
